Paige added a 64 button AOM each to two extensions using ports 7 and 8 of a Compact (motherboard ports) and was able to program the first 50 buttons as system wide speed dial buttons, they have 200 system wide numbers.
On the last 14 of the 64, she could not add any more system wide speed dials, nor could she change the buttons from the preprogrammed DS to anything else.
I know we gave each phone 50 personal speed dials but that should not affect adding 64 system wide to the AOMs.
I've never seen this one before, have you?
